Handover Note — Lease Renegotiation, Aldermoor Site

For the finance team, from outgoing director Marit Solheim to incoming director Dele Anwasi. Negotiations with Greystack Properties on the Aldermoor lease are midway. We've secured a provisional rent reduction in exchange for a longer term; break clauses are still contested. Budget impact models sit with the property accountant. Keep payment schedules unchanged until signature. The broader occupancy strategy agreed with the board is noted confidentially below.

confidential, bahip-hadug: Headcount on the Norir team goes from 29 to 116 by the end of August. Gross margin on Norir came in at 6 percent against a plan of 59 percent.

Runbook: Cron Drift Triage — Pellwick Batch Platform. If nightly jobs on the Ostrander cluster fire late, start by comparing the scheduler's internal tick log against the hardware clock on each runner. Drift usually traces back to a paused VM or a stale timezone bundle. After correcting drift, you must re-sign and redeploy the scheduler image so the fleet accepts it; unsigned images are rejected automatically. Signing happens through the Marrow pipeline, which requires the key that follows.

rollout seal: bky4_yke3

Alert: Deep-Link Routing Failures — Hopstitch Mobile

This alert fires when more than 5% of inbound deep links in the Hopstitch app fail to resolve to their target screen within 10 seconds. Users typically report landing on the home screen instead of the shared content. Support should first confirm the user is on app version 4.2 or later and ask them to retry the link. If failures persist across multiple users, report the pattern to the routing team at the address below.

escalation mailbox, bafog-fafog: ulador@paliqlabs.internal